Q: WHAT CLASS SHOULD I START WITH?

A: Any of our Intro Courses or Level 1 classes are great places to start.  

 

Each apparatus has its own challenges. On pole you can expect you feel a pinch on the skin as you use you skin to stick while holding you sits and poses. The hoop is a thin bar that will dig in a little while moving from poses to pose. The hammock will give you a good squeeze as we wrap and twist through shapes and combos. Lastly, Fabpole combines pole and hammock so you can expect a combination of sensations and potentially some dizziness, as this class is all done on a spin pole. All our apparatuses are fun we suggest you give everything a try!

Q: CAN I ATTEND ANY LEVEL OF CLASS?

A: Yes and no. We ask that you try to stay at your level but sometimes our schedule does not always allow that. You can go to a lower level class then what you are training at but you CANNOT go to a higher level class. When you are attending a lower level class you will be doing the lower level skills that the instructor has prepared for the class. It is always good to have a refresher and go over old skills so please be respectful and only practice the skills that are being taught at that class or what the instructor is giving you.

Q: WHAT IF I HAVE NO UPPER BODY STRENGTH?

A: No problem! Our classes are designed to build strength while you learn new skills. Most of our students begin class with little upper body strength and are able to execute skills and tricks that don't require a high strength level.

Q:WHAT SHOULD I WEAR?

A: This depends on the apparatus, and trick/skill being taught.

​

POLE: Usually shorts and a tank top to start, as we work towards more advanced skills we need more skin for proper stick. This is up to you and your comfort level, but most students wear bra tops and pole shorts.

​

HOOP: The hoop we train with is taped, which can be rough on our skin, so we suggest leggings and a fitted t-shirt or tank top.

​

HAMMOCK: While in the hammock we can experience fabric burn, so we suggest leggings and a fitted t-shirt or tank top.

​

FABPOLE: This apparatus combines pole and hammock, we can experience fabric burn and also need skin for proper stick. We suggest leggings and a fitted t-shirt or tank top, and recommend bringing shorts along.
